- Kevin RogersBaylor forward Kevin Rogers started the year in Greece when he signed for Panionios. However, he played in only three games for the team before being released, averaging 6.0 points and 6.3 rebounds, shooting 9-21 from the field and 0-0 from the foul line. (Panionios replaced him with Travon Bryant.) Rogers then kicked around until late February, when he signed in the D-League and was acquired by the Rio Grande Valley Vipers. He averaged 7.4 points, 3.0 rebounds and 3.2 fouls in his first 9 games with the team, but suffered a season ending knee injury in his eighth game.
